Heterogeneous nuclear r ibonuc leopro te ins (hnRNPs) associate with RNA polymerase II transcripts immediately following the initiation of transcription to form hnRNP complexes. These structures are the functional assemblies within which hnRNAs and pre-mRNAs exist in the nucleus. The hnRNP descriptive has been used to refer to the totality of proteins whose primary binding site is hnRNA, and/or its associated proteins, as well as exclusively those six proteins associated with nuclease-resistant particles isolated from sucrose gradients. For this review, all of the proteins which have been demonstrated to interact with hnRNAs/pre-mRNAs will be covered. In addition, only those studies reported since the last European RNP meeting in 1987, will be discussed; extensive reviews of previous literature are available (Chung & Wooley, 1986;Dreyfuss, 1986).
